Fifty years ago, ABC‘s Certain Women marked a shift in putting the primary focus in Australian television drama on women. Up until then, Australian television drama was largely male-dominated. Division 4 star Gerard Kennedy won the Gold Logie for Most Popular Personality on Australian Television at the 14th annual TV Week Logie Awards. The awards were held at Melbourne’s Southern Cross Hotel on 18 February 1972 and hosted by Bert Newton. The Nine Network telecast was shown live to Sydney and Melbourne and for …

In the 1980s one of the Nine Network‘s many strengths was its early afternoons. The Mike Walsh Show, which became Midday with Ray Martin, followed by US soaps Days Of Our Lives and The Young And The Restless constantly beat anything thrown at them by rival commercial networks Seven and Ten.
